Subject: [PATCH infiniband-diags] ibtracert.c: Remove checking the port 0 state for BasePort0 switches
Date: Tue, 20 Jan 2015 07:59:55 -0500 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<54BE514B.5030904@dev.mellanox.co.il> (raw)
From: Dan Ben Yosef <danby-VPRAkNaXOzVWk0Htik3J/w@public.gmane.org>
The port 0 state check is needed only for HCA/Routers and
EnhancedPort0 switches.
For BasePort0 switches, the PortState field in the PortInfo attribute
for port0 is undefined (not used).
